For those looking to add a little sparkle and mystery to their trip to Washington, DC, The Good Liar show featuring magician Brian Curry offers an intriguing escape from typical sightseeing. This 1-hour performance takes place in a cozy, accessible venue near the heart of the city, where you’ll witness jaw-dropping illusions, clever deception, and a good dose of humor. Tickets are flexible, with the option to reserve now and pay later, making it an easy addition to your DC itinerary.
What makes this experience stand out? First, we love Brian’s masterful blend of magic and storytelling, which keeps you guessing and entertained from start to finish. Second, we appreciate the performance’s intimacy—you’re not just a faceless audience member but part of a lively, engaging act that guarantees laughs and surprises. That said, keep in mind that children under 15 might find the show a bit mature or complex, so it suits an older crowd or families with teens.
A small potential drawback? The duration is just one hour, which is perfect if you’re tight on time, but some might wish for a slightly longer show to dive deeper into the art of deception. Still, the quality and engagement make those 60 minutes feel surprisingly full and satisfying.
If you’re someone who enjoys interactive entertainment, appreciates clever illusions, and prefers a friendly, relaxed atmosphere, this tour is well-suited for you. It’s particularly ideal if you want an evening activity that’s different from the typical museum or monument tour but still offers authentic, memorable fun.

An In-Depth Look at “The Good Liar” with Brian Curry

When you arrive at the venue—marked clearly with signs for The Good Liar—you’ll step into a space that feels intimate and slightly mysterious. The magic happens in a setting designed to foster connection and curiosity, making the audience feel like part of the show rather than just passive spectators.
Brian Curry’s magic tricks are renowned for being mind-bending and lively, often involving audience participation that heightens the fun and keeps everyone guessing. We loved the way he combines sleight of hand, storytelling, and humor—making each trick not just a clever illusion but also a story that draws you in. From the reviews, many mention the “wonder of Brian Curry’s tricks” and how his performance leaves audiences in awe, often accompanied by bursts of laughter.

What to Expect During the Show
The show is concise—just one hour—but packed with surprises. Expect several magic tricks and illusions that challenge your perceptions and leave you questioning what’s real. The performance is designed to be engaging and interactive, with Curry inviting audience members to participate, breaking down the traditional magic show into something more personal and memorable.
While specific tricks are not detailed in the available information, the reviews suggest that Curry’s mastery of deception is so convincing that many in the audience find it hard to believe their eyes. The experience guarantees laughter and awe, making it a great option for those seeking an evening of pure entertainment.
The Venue and Accessibility
The meeting point is conveniently located with clear signage, and the coordinates provided (38.903221130371094, -77.03572082519531) make it easy to find, whether you’re walking or using public transport. The venue is wheelchair accessible, ensuring a welcoming environment for all guests.
